正则表达式分为两类:基本正则表达式和扩展正则表达式。基本正则表达式元字符:字符匹配:.:匹配任意一个字符。[]:匹配[]中指定范围内的任意一个字符。[^]:指定范围外的任意一个字符;也可以得知,在[]括号内,^表示取反。次数匹配:*:其前面字符出现任意次。\?:其前字符出现0..
分类:
其他好文 时间:
2017-05-30 00:10:02
阅读次数:
208
shell编程正則表達式: 1:元字符 [ ] . * ? + ( ) | { } ^ $ 2 : [a-z0-9] 表示匹配随意数字和字母的一个 3 : [^a-z] 匹配除了字母的随意一个 4 : ab+c +表示匹配一个或多个+号前面的字符 5 : ab*c *表示匹配没有或多个*号前面的字符 ...
分类:
系统相关 时间:
2017-05-29 16:39:34
阅读次数:
268
一、正则表达式:正则表达式(或称RegularExpression,简称RE)就是由普通字符(例如字符a到z)以及特殊字符(称为元字符)组成的文字模式。该模式描述在查找文字主体时待匹配的一个或多个字符串。正则表达式作为一个模板,将某个字符模式与所搜索的字符串进行匹配。简单的说,..
分类:
系统相关 时间:
2017-05-27 23:53:19
阅读次数:
369
元字符 描述 \ 将下一个字符标记符、或一个向后引用、或一个八进制转义符。 例如,“\\n”匹配\n。“\n”匹配换行符。序列“\\”匹配“\”而“\(”则匹配“(”。即相当于多种编程语言中都有的“转义字符”的概念。 ^ 匹配输入字符串的开始位置。如果设置了RegExp对象的Multiline属性, ...
分类:
其他好文 时间:
2017-05-26 10:58:30
阅读次数:
220
元字符 描述 \ 将下一个字符标记符、或一个向后引用、或一个八进制转义符。例如,“\\n”匹配\n。“\n”匹配换行符。序列“\\”匹配“\”而“\(”则匹配“(”。即相当于多种编程语言中都有的“转义字符”的概念。 ^ 匹配输入字符串的开始位置。如果设置了RegExp对象的Multiline属性,^ ...
分类:
其他好文 时间:
2017-05-25 13:21:08
阅读次数:
198
什么是正则表达式 正则表达式(Regular Expression)是一种文本模式,在编写处理字符串的程序或网页时,经常会有查找符合某些规则的字符串的需求。正则表达式就是用于描述这些规则的工具,换句话说,正则表达式就是记录文本规则的代码。 一、正则表达式常用字符 1) 常用元字符 2) 常用限定符 ...
分类:
其他好文 时间:
2017-05-20 13:54:04
阅读次数:
102
<? //原子 $express='a'; //一个字符[]() //一个表达式可以由很多个原子组成 //一丶正则表达式: //1原子 //一个字符[](){} //2元字符(特殊字符) //+表示前面的原子表达式可以是1到n个 //*表示前面的原子表达式可以是0到n个 //注:.*.+[a-z]* ...
分类:
其他好文 时间:
2017-05-18 20:09:23
阅读次数:
186
转自http://www.cnblogs.com/xiaohuochai/p/5608807.html 元字符 大部分字符在正则表达式中,就是字面的含义,比如/a/匹配a,/b/匹配b 但还有一些字符,它们除了字面意思外,还有着特殊的含义,这些字符就是元字符 在javascript中,共有14个元字 ...
分类:
其他好文 时间:
2017-05-17 17:30:29
阅读次数:
614
re模块功能:实现字符串匹配。元字符 描述\ 将下一个字符标记符、或一个向后引用、或一个八进制转义符。例如,“\\n”匹配\n。“\n”匹配换行符。序列“\\”匹配“\”而“\(”则匹配“(”。即相当于多种编程语言中都有的“转义字符”的概念。^ 匹配输入字符串的开始位置。如果设置了RegExp对象的... ...
分类:
编程语言 时间:
2017-05-12 13:34:10
阅读次数:
302
oracle 截取字符(substr),检索字符位置(instr) case when then else end语句使用 收藏 常用函数:substr和instr1.SUBSTR(string,start_position,[length]) 求子字符串,返回字符串解释:string 元字符串 s ...
分类:
数据库 时间:
2017-05-12 10:45:09
阅读次数:
204